The Problem
Problem Context
Personal trainers and fitness coaches create social media videos to attract clients, but filming in busy gyms with mixed lighting and background noise makes their content look unprofessional. They spend hours manually editing to achieve a 'crisp, high-quality' look, which is time-consuming and inconsistent. Without polished videos, they struggle to grow their following and convert viewers into paying clients.
Pain Points
Trainers face three main challenges: (1. Lighting issues—mixed gym lighting makes videos look washed out or too dark, (2. Background noise—clanking weights and chatter ruin audio quality, and (3) Time wasted editing—manual fixes take hours per video, slowing down content creation. They’ve tried free tools like CapCut or iMovie, but these lack gym-specific optimizations, and hiring freelancers is expensive and unreliable.

Proposed AI Solution
Solution Approach
An AI-powered video editor designed specifically for fitness professionals. Upload raw gym footage, and the tool automatically fixes lighting, removes background noise, and frames the video using gym-specific templates. The result is a high-quality, professional-looking video ready for social media—all in minutes, with no editing skills required. The product focuses on ease of use, speed, and gym-optimized outputs to save trainers time and improve their content quality.
Key Features
- Background Noise Reduction: AI filters out gym noise (e.g., weights, chatter) to deliver clean audio without manual editing.
- Gym-Specific Templates: Pre-set video compositions for common exercises (e.g., squats, deadlifts) to ensure proper framing and professional presentation.
- One-Click Export: Optimizes videos for Instagram, TikTok, or YouTube with the best settings for each platform.
User Experience
Trainers upload their raw footage via a web dashboard or mobile app. They select a template (e.g., 'Form Check Video' or 'HIIT Workout Clip') and let the AI process the video in the background. Within minutes, they receive a high-quality video ready to post. The tool handles all technical fixes automatically, so users don’t need editing skills. They can also customize branding (e.g., gym logos, colors) and download the final video in one click.
Differentiation
Unlike generic video editors (e.g., CapCut, iMovie) or freelance services, this tool is built *for- fitness professionals. It includes gym-specific optimizations (e.g., lighting profiles for indoor spaces, noise reduction for weight rooms) and templates tailored to common exercises. Free tools lack these features, and hiring editors is expensive and inconsistent. The product’s AI models are trained on fitness video data, making it far more accurate than general-purpose tools.
